Church Painting in Saint Petersburg, FL
Church painting services encompass a range of exterior and interior painting projects tailored to religious buildings and similar properties. These services typically include surface preparation, such as cleaning and sanding, followed by applying high-quality paints and finishes designed to enhance durability and appearance. Projects may involve repainting sanctuary walls, updating entryways, or refreshing other architectural features to improve the building’s aesthetic appeal and protect it from weathering and wear.
Property owners interested in church painting often want to understand the scope of work, including surface preparation, paint choices, and the expected longevity of the finish. It’s also common to inquire about color options, the suitability of specific paints for different surfaces, and any necessary surface repairs before painting begins. Clarifying these details can help ensure the project meets expectations for appearance, durability, and maintenance needs.

Church Painting Questions
What types of church painting projects are common? Typical projects include interior wall painting, exterior surface refreshes, and decorative finishes for church interiors and exteriors.
What surfaces can be painted on a church? Surfaces such as drywall, wood, stucco, brick, and concrete are suitable for painting depending on the project requirements.
Is special preparation needed before painting a church? Yes, surfaces are usually cleaned, patched, and primed to ensure proper adhesion and a smooth finish.
What colors are suitable for church painting? Traditional and neutral colors are common, but custom color choices can reflect the church’s style and community preferences.
